4.0 out of 5 stars Not That "New" But Very Good, May 4, 2010
This review is from: This Is New (Audio CD)
Kenny Drew's Undercurrent (see my review) is one of my favorite lesser-known Blue Note albums, but before the pianist rejoined the label in 1960 (he also made some sides in the early 50s for them), he recorded several sessions for Riverside. "This Is New" collects two of those dates -- the first three tracks hail from a March 28, 1957 quintet session featuring Donald Byrd, Hank Mobley, Wilbur Ware and drummer G.T. Hogan, while the remaining selections are from a week later on April 3rd, this time as a quartet with everyone above except Mobley. Contrary to the title, there isn't much "new" about this disc, though it is a solid hard bop outing. With this title going out-of-print like so many OJC CDs, interested parties should get "This Is New" before it gets old and dies.
